Why Consider an Energy Saving Freezer?
A freezer is an essential component for food preservation, especially in families that buy groceries in bulk. Standard freezers tend to take in considerable quantities of energy and may lead to higher utility bills. Energy-saving freezers, on the other hand, are designed to lessen energy consumption while making the most of performance. Here are some key advantages of changing to an energy-efficient model:
Cost Savings: The most immediate benefit is the reduction in electrical power expenses. Energy-efficient freezers are built to use less electricity, so users can save money in time.
Environmental Impact: By utilizing less energy, we decrease the demand on power plants, which contributes to reduce greenhouse gas emissions.
Improved Technology: Many contemporary energy-saving freezers are equipped with innovative technologies such as better insulation, efficient compressors, and temperature management systems that increase performance and reliability.
Secret Features of Energy Saving Freezers
When checking out the market for an energy-efficient freezer, it's important to think about a number of features that differentiate them from conventional models:
1. Energy Star Certification
Products that are Energy Star certified meet stringent energy efficiency standards. This certification ensures customers that the device will consume less energy and is more environmentally friendly.
2. Advanced Insulation
Quality insulation assists preserve low temperatures without exhausting the compressor, which can lead to significant cost savings in energy costs.
3. Variable Speed Compressors
Unlike standard models that perform at complete speed all the time, variable speed compressors change their operation based on the interior temperature level of the Deep Freezer Chest, using less energy when full capability isn't required.
4. Adaptive Defrost
Freezers with adaptive defrost capabilities instantly determine when to defrost based on the user's habits, further optimizing energy usage.
5. Temperature Level and Humidity Control
Advanced temperature management systems preserve constant temperature levels while managing humidity levels, which can help maintain food quality and decrease energy usage.
